中文摘要
AST-0307747研究人员将开发一种形式和物理模型来描述暗物质晕的子结构和形状。 解析模型假设宇宙中的质量被束缚在球形和光滑的晕中,但数值模拟现在有足够的分辨率来表明它们实际上是三轴的,而且相当明亮。 这项工作将使用引力透镜观测来约束宇宙质量功率谱的小尺度端,约束晕轮廓,并解释宇宙剪切场的测量。 它将支持模拟星系的光度函数及其演化,预测星系和气体在星系团中的分布,以及使用高阶统计来打破与两点统计测量相关的宇宙学参数之间的简并性。 广泛的应用范围使这项工作成为一个很好的统一框架,在这个框架内,研究生和本科生可以在大规模结构中了解主题。
英文摘要
AST-0307747ShethThe investigators will develop a formalism and physical models to describe the substructure and shapes of dark matter halos. Analytic models have assumed that the mass in the universe is bound up in halos which are both spherical and smooth, but numerical simulations now have sufficient resolution to show that they are actually triaxial and rather lumpy. This work will use gravitational lensing observations to constrain the small scale end of the cosmological mass power spectrum, to constrain halo profiles, and to interpret measurements of the cosmic shear field. It will support modeling the luminosity function of galaxies and its evolution, predicting the distribution of galaxies and gas in clusters, and the use of higher order statistics to break the degeneracy between cosmological parameters associated with measurements of two point statistics. The wide range of applications makes this work a good unified framework within which to introduce graduate and undergraduate students to topics in large-scale structure.***
